Wildly inaccurate. It’s a good mix of debtor / creditor / UCC work. They have an announcement on their LinkedIn showing the deals they closed in 2024. They did quite a few billion dollar non UCCs (also, a several billion dollar UCC still looks amazing on your resume, and the PE / PC guys will rarely know the difference. Really only affects you if you’re recruiting for a workout role / distressed fund.). Also pretty solid exits. Definitely not a PJT, but “shit” is the worst way to put it.

Also the London guys are killing it. Just very new so non cemented on the street.

Overall, I’d probably put them above Greenhill / Piper, but below Guggenheim / PWP
